No dog in the world has a silhouette quite like a dachshund.
The long body, the short stubby legs, the oversized ears, the extended nose, and the cheerful upright tail combine to create one of the most immediately recognizable and universally beloved dog breeds in existence. The dachshund was bred in Germany several centuries ago specifically to hunt badgers, its long body designed to follow prey into underground burrows and its loud, carrying voice designed to alert hunters above ground to its location below. The name dachshund means badger dog in German. The diminutive frame contains a personality of considerable courage, stubbornness, and character, which is part of why the breed has inspired such devoted ownership across every country and culture that has encountered it.

The Dachshund in Culture
The dachshund has achieved a cultural presence far beyond its size. In Germany it remains a national symbol of sorts, appearing on everything from traditional Bavarian ceramics to contemporary design objects. In Britain the dachshund was enormously popular with the Victorian aristocracy before anti-German sentiment during the First World War temporarily damaged its reputation. In the United States the dachshund has been consistently among the most popular breeds for over a century. In Japan the dachshund inspires a devoted following that has produced dachshund cafes, dachshund merchandise, and an entire aesthetic subculture around the breed's distinctive silhouette.
The dachshund inspires this devotion because its personality is as distinctive as its shape. Stubborn, brave, affectionate, opinionated, and absolutely convinced of its own importance despite its physical dimensions, the dachshund is a character as much as a breed. Why were dachshunds originally bred?
The dachshund was bred in Germany several centuries ago to hunt badgers, which live in underground burrows. The breed's long body was designed to follow badgers into their tunnels, and its short powerful legs were designed to dig. The loud, carrying voice was essential for alerting hunters above ground to the dog's location underground. Despite its diminutive appearance the dachshund is a genuine working hunting breed of considerable courage and tenacity.
